In our second bonus episode of Season 2, we’re sitting down with the creatives behind the Mount Holyoke College (MHC) production of William Shakespeare’s Much Ado About Nothing. IFQT! producer, host, and the MHC Much Ado About Nothing Assistant Director, Lily Mueller (they/she/he), leads us in a roundtable discussion with this uniquely queer, trans, and neurodiverse cast, crew, and creative team. In this episode, you’ll hear these artists talk about their experiences working on this production, queering the arts, the importance of theater, and some of their visions for a perfect future.
